After teasing something new on social media earlier this month, Bright Eyes have resurfaced with new posters plastered in several locations.
Over the past few days, people have spotted eye-chart-inspired Bright Eyes posters, and the band has even been posting them to their Instagram stories. The line beneath the divider varies between poster, and fans are speculating that they’re abbreviations for venues like Forest Hills Stadium in NYC, Hollywood Palladium in LA, and End of the Road Festival.
